Subject: [Qemu-devel] [PATCH v1 09/27] target/s390x: factor out handling of WAIT PSW into handle_wait()
Date: Mon, 18 Sep 2017 17:59:54 +0200

This will now also detect crashes under TCG. We can directly use
cpu->env.psw.addr instead of kvm_run, as we do a
cpu_synchronize_state().

Signed-off-by: David Hildenbrand <address@hidden>
---
 target/s390x/helper.c   | 28 ++++++++++++++++++++++------
 target/s390x/internal.h |  1 +
 target/s390x/kvm.c      | 15 +--------------
 3 files changed, 24 insertions(+), 20 deletions(-)

diff --git a/target/s390x/helper.c b/target/s390x/helper.c
index e22b93258b..75ceb0bf2b 100644
--- a/target/s390x/helper.c
+++ b/target/s390x/helper.c
@@ -26,6 +26,7 @@
 #include "qemu/timer.h"
 #include "exec/exec-all.h"
 #include "hw/s390x/ioinst.h"
+#include "sysemu/hw_accel.h"
 #ifndef CONFIG_USER_ONLY
 #include "sysemu/sysemu.h"
 #endif
@@ -113,6 +114,26 @@ hwaddr s390_cpu_get_phys_addr_debug(CPUState *cs, vaddr 
vaddr)
     return phys_addr;
 }
 
+static inline bool is_special_wait_psw(uint64_t psw_addr)
+{
+    /* signal quiesce */
+    return psw_addr == 0xfffUL;
+}
+
+void handle_wait(S390CPU *cpu)
+{
+    cpu_synchronize_state(CPU(cpu));
+    if (s390_cpu_halt(cpu) == 0) {
+#ifndef CONFIG_USER_ONLY
+        if (is_special_wait_psw(cpu->env.psw.addr)) {
+            qemu_system_shutdown_request(SHUTDOWN_CAUSE_GUEST_SHUTDOWN);
+        } else {
+            qemu_system_guest_panicked(NULL);
+        }
+#endif
+    }
+}
+
 void load_psw(CPUS390XState *env, uint64_t mask, uint64_t addr)
 {
     uint64_t old_mask = env->psw.mask;
@@ -128,12 +149,7 @@ void load_psw(CPUS390XState *env, uint64_t mask, uint64_t 
addr)
     }
 
     if (mask & PSW_MASK_WAIT) {
-        S390CPU *cpu = s390_env_get_cpu(env);
-        if (s390_cpu_halt(cpu) == 0) {
-#ifndef CONFIG_USER_ONLY
-            qemu_system_shutdown_request(SHUTDOWN_CAUSE_GUEST_SHUTDOWN);
-#endif
-        }
+        handle_wait(s390_env_get_cpu(env));
     }
 }
 
diff --git a/target/s390x/internal.h b/target/s390x/internal.h
index 15743ec40f..cb331f35ea 100644
--- a/target/s390x/internal.h
+++ b/target/s390x/internal.h
@@ -280,6 +280,7 @@ const char *cc_name(enum cc_op cc_op);
 void load_psw(CPUS390XState *env, uint64_t mask, uint64_t addr);
 uint32_t calc_cc(CPUS390XState *env, uint32_t cc_op, uint64_t src, uint64_t 
dst,
                  uint64_t vr);
+void handle_wait(S390CPU *cpu);
 
 
 /* cpu.c */
diff --git a/target/s390x/kvm.c b/target/s390x/kvm.c
index 3f9983154f..14f864697d 100644
--- a/target/s390x/kvm.c
+++ b/target/s390x/kvm.c
@@ -1936,12 +1936,6 @@ static int handle_instruction(S390CPU *cpu, struct 
kvm_run *run)
     return r;
 }
 
-static bool is_special_wait_psw(CPUState *cs)
-{
-    /* signal quiesce */
-    return cs->kvm_run->psw_addr == 0xfffUL;
-}
-
 static void unmanageable_intercept(S390CPU *cpu, const char *str, int 
pswoffset)
 {
     CPUState *cs = CPU(cpu);
@@ -2012,14 +2006,7 @@ static int handle_intercept(S390CPU *cpu)
             break;
         case ICPT_WAITPSW:
             /* disabled wait, since enabled wait is handled in kernel */
-            cpu_synchronize_state(cs);
-            if (s390_cpu_halt(cpu) == 0) {
-                if (is_special_wait_psw(cs)) {
-                    
qemu_system_shutdown_request(SHUTDOWN_CAUSE_GUEST_SHUTDOWN);
-                } else {
-                    qemu_system_guest_panicked(NULL);
-                }
-            }
+            handle_wait(cpu);
             r = EXCP_HALTED;
             break;
         case ICPT_CPU_STOP:
